How to Buy Vintage Art Posters

How to Buy Vintage Art Posters thumbnail
Buy Vintage Art Posters

The trend toward posters featuring vintage art has been beneficial to homeowners with an eye for style. Vintage art posters replicate paintings and pop culture events without a high price to the consumer. You need to know how to buy vintage art posters to maximize your investment and show your love of art to friends.

Instructions

    • 1

      Ponder past advertising campaigns as you determine which vintage art posters you want to buy. A popular genre of vintage art posters is advertisements for war bonds during the Second World War because of their unique styles.

    • 2

      Collect movie posters from the early years of the movie industry as part of your home decor. You can find movie posters from most major releases in the 1930s and 1940s to give your home a movie house feel.

    • 3

      Plan out a chronological approach to vintage art before you buy your first posters. You can line your hallways and living room with framed posters to make your visitors feel as if they are traveling back in time.

    • 4

      Work with galleries and vintage poster retailers to find frames that fit your interior design motif. You should take pictures of empty spaces where your posters will be hung for the benefit of the framer.

    • 5

      Attend city museums with long-term exhibits covering a certain topic to find vintage art posters. Museums with exhibitions on advertising, television and other pop culture phenomena will typically have replica posters in their gift shops.

    • 6

      Research the significance of images on vintage art posters to avoid unintended political messages. Propaganda pieces during war time and movie posters about politically incorrect topics can cause offense out of context.

    • 7

      Look for advertisements on local college websites to find poster sales featuring vintage art posters. These sales take place at the beginning of each semester to help students cover their dorm room walls. You can find replicas of your favorite vintage art at a low price at these sales.

    • 8

      Take photos of art pieces and other creative efforts in your daily life to help find posters at a later time. You can take each photo, place the artist or product name beneath the photo and look through this album as you prepare to shop for vintage posters.

Tips & Warnings

  • Measure the amount of space for vintage art posters in your home before you make a purchase. You need to know the square footage available in your living room, office and bedroom to find posters in the right sizes. It is important to consider surrounding decor in your measurements to find the best posters possible.
